CBSE Issued Notification for CTET: Central Teacher Eligibility Test by the Central Board of Secondary Education i.e. Central Board of Secondary Education (CBSE). (CTET) Notification has been issued.
It is necessary to be CTET qualified
Eligible candidates till 16th October ctet.nic.in You can fill the application form by visiting. Its exam will be held on 1 December 2024. It is known that for jobs in central government schools, it is necessary to be CTET qualified.
Apart from this, one can also get jobs on this basis in schools of Chandigarh, Dadra and Nagar Haveli, Daman and Diu, Andaman and Nicobar Islands, Lakshadweep and Delhi.
These include Kendriya Vidyalaya, Navodaya Vidyalaya (Navodaya Vidyalaya) Like schools are included. Application Fee: General / OBC (Non-Creamy Layer): If you are appearing in either Paper 1 or Paper II, you will have to pay a fee of Rs 1000. If you are giving both Paper I and Paper II then you will have to pay a fee of Rs 1200.
Whereas for SC, ST and Divyang, if you are giving either Paper 1 or Paper II, then you will have to pay a fee of Rs 500. If you are giving both Paper I and Paper II then you will have to pay a fee of Rs 600.
